PHP 配置 MySQL 数据库需要修改 php.ini 文件,设置 extension_dir 和 extension 参数来启用 mysqli 扩展。在 PHP 代码中,使用 mysqli_connect() 函数建立与 MySQL 数据库的连接,并处理可能的连接错误。
在PHP开发中,配置并连接MySQL数据库是一项基础且关键的步骤,本文将详细介绍如何通过PHP代码连接到MySQL数据库,并执行常见的数据库操作,包括增删改查等,具体分析如下:
(图片来源网络,侵删)
1、使用mysql_connect()
函数连接MySQL服务器
功能描述:mysql_connect()
是PHP中用于建立与MySQL服务器连接的函数。
参数详解:该函数需要三个参数,分别是服务器地址(通常为’localhost’)、用户名和密码。
应用实例:在实际使用中,如果服务器运行在本地,可以使用’localhost’作为服务器地址,同时确保提供正确的用户名和密码以成功建立连接。
2、选择数据库
功能描述:一旦连接建立,使用mysql_select_db()
函数来选择需要操作的数据库。
参数详解:该函数接受两个参数,第一个是已建立的MySQL服务器连接,第二个是想要选择的数据库名称。
(图片来源网络,侵删)
应用实例:如果已经使用mysql_connect()
成功连接到MySQL服务器,并且有一个名为testdb
的数据库,可以使用mysql_select_db('testdb', $connection)
来选择这个数据库进行后续操作。
3、执行SQL语句
功能描述:使用mysql_query()
函数来在选定的数据库上执行SQL语句。
支持的操作:这个函数支持多种类型的SQL操作,包括查询(select)、插入(insert into)、更新(update)和删除(delete)数据。
应用实例:要向表users
插入一条新记录,可以使用类似mysql_query("INSERT INTO users (name, age) VALUES ('John', 25)", $connection)
的语句实现数据的插入操作。
4、创建数据库和数据表
功能描述:除了常规的数据库操作,PHP还可以用于创建数据库和数据表,这通常通过执行特定的SQL语句完成。
(图片来源网络,侵删)
应用实例:使用CREATE DATABASE dbname;
来创建一个新的数据库,然后使用USE dbname;
来选择这个新数据库进行后续操作。
5、添加字段和插入数据
功能描述:在数据库和数据表创建完成后,可以通过PHP执行ALTER TABLE语句来添加新的字段,使用INSERT语句来插入数据。
应用实例:如果要在users
表中添加一个新字段email
,可以使用ALTER TABLE users ADD email VARCHAR( 255 );
这样的语句来实现。
在了解以上内容后,以下还有一些其他注意事项:
安全性:始终确保使用最新的稳定版PHP和MySQL,并保持软件更新,以防止安全漏洞。
性能优化:适当地使用索引可以大幅提升数据库查询速度。
错误处理:使用trycatch结构或错误处理函数来管理可能出现的错误或异常。
PHP与MySQL的结合为开发者提供了强大的数据库操作能力,从连接数据库到执行复杂的SQL语句,PHP都能够通过丰富的函数和方法实现,正确地使用这些工具不仅可以提升开发效率,还可以确保应用程序的稳定性和安全性。
评论(0)